Charities come together for fund-raising market at Tails and Whiskers Charity Shop

Community members and charities came together when Tails and Whiskers Charity Shop held a market for its beneficiaries.

Held on April 9, the market was described as a success by Tails and Whiskers founder Sharon Blackwell.

Beneficiaries who had stalls at the market included Edenvale Ferals, Warriors for Africa’s Wildlife and Hellen White – In the Community.

“We appreciate the support from the community, especially on such a cold day,” said Sharon.

She explained the store’s mini-markets allow beneficiaries of Tails and Whiskers the opportunity to raise funds.

The next market will be held on Freedom Day (April 27), with another scheduled for Mother’s Day (May 7).

Besides inviting community members to the upcoming markets, Sharon encouraged those cleaning out their homes to consider donating any unwanted items, in a good condition, to the charity store.

The Third Street store sells second-hand items donated to it to raise funds for several animal organisations in Gauteng.

Donations can be delivered at the store’s back gate located on Eighth Avenue on Mondays and Fridays between 10:00 and 16:00.

“Anything in a good condition will be greatly appreciated,” said Sharon.

Following the store’s re-opening its doors in 2020 after lockdown a back garden was created.

The back garden is open on Saturdays between 10:00 and 13:00.
